What they do
A Process Engineer solves problems related to the manufacturing and use of products, including chemicals, fuel, food, and clothing. Designs new products, improves existing ones, or develops new processes for better use of existing materials. May specialize in a chemical engineering process, such as making plastics, or in an industry such as health care.

Job Description
As a Senior Process Engineer , you will play a dual role, supporting day-to-day manufacturing operations while spearheading long-term continuous improvement initiatives. Your immediate focus will be troubleshooting and optimizing extrusion processes with an emphasis on improving process equipment reliability and Overall Equipment Effectiveness (OEE). By addressing these key areas, you will drive significant gains in operational efficiency and equipment performance. In this role, you will lead strategic process enhancements that align with James Hardie's manufacturing goals, ensuring both short-term operational success and long-term innovation. Your expertise will be critical in identifying and resolving inefficiencies in extrusion processes, reducing downtime, and maximizing equipment utilization. With a proactive approach to sustainable improvement, you will combine technical problem-solving with process optimization, contributing to James Hardie's commitment to operational excellence and continuous improvement in line with the company's Core Values.
Essential Duties and Responsibilities:
Direct Manufacturing Support:
Provide hands-on technical support for extrusion processes, resolving issues related to process flow, equipment functionality, material inconsistencies, and quality deviations. Investigate and address daily operational challenges, including equipment failures, quality non-conformance, safety concerns, using root cause analysis and Six Sigma methodologies. Collaborate with Maintenance and Manufacturing teams to ensure equipment uptime. Troubleshoot and validate new or idled equipment during commissioning, repair, upgrade, or replacement to ensure safe, efficient integration into production and alignment with operational goals.
Long-Term Strategic Continuous Improvement:
Lead cross-functional teams to design, develop, and implement process improvements that increase productivity, reduce costs, and enhance safety and quality. Analyze process data to identify opportunities for improvement. Develop and implement Standard Operating Procedures (SOPs) and protocols for equipment to ensure long-term consistency and efficiency. Recommend capital investment projects, factoring in long-term risk, cost, and operational benefits, while managing capital spending for upgraded and replacement equipment. Lead initiatives integrating automation and digital tools to optimize processes and drive sustainable performance improvements. Apply Lean, Six Sigma, and other methodologies to implement innovative solutions that support long-term operational goals. Collaborate with external vendors and stay informed about emerging technologies for future process enhancements.
Quality Control & Compliance:
Implement and refine quality control measures to ensure the consistency and integrity of extruded products. Ensure compliance with safety regulations, industry standards, and environmental guidelines in both immediate and long-term operations.
Communication & Stakeholder Engagement:
Communicate project milestones, process improvements, and technical recommendations to stakeholders through detailed reports and presentations. Collaborate with cross-functional teams, including R&D, Maintenance, Quality, and Production, to align short-term operational needs with long-term strategic goals.
